Blood sugar, or glucose, is the primary source of energy for the body's cells. It comes from the food we eat, and its levels in the blood are tightly regulated by insulin, a hormone produced by the pancreas. For individuals without diabetes, this regulation usually works seamlessly. However, for those with diabetes, this process is disrupted, leading to either high (hyperglycemia) or low (hypoglycemia) blood sugar levels.

Here's why maintaining a normal blood sugar range is essential:

  • Reduces the risk of complications: Consistently high blood sugar levels can damage blood vessels, nerves, and organs over time, leading to serious complications like heart disease, kidney disease, and nerve damage.
  • Improves energy levels and overall well-being: Stable blood sugar levels translate to consistent energy, better mood, and improved cognitive function.
  • Enhances the effectiveness of diabetes management: Understanding your target range and how to achieve it empowers you to take control of your diabetes and live a healthier life.

Understanding Target Blood Sugar Ranges for Diabetics

For individuals with diabetes, target blood sugar ranges vary slightly based on individual factors and the type of diabetes they have. The American Diabetes Association (ADA) provides general guidelines that serve as a useful starting point. However, it's essential to consult with your healthcare provider to determine the specific range that is right for you.

Here are the generally recommended target ranges:

| Time of Day | Target Range (mg/dL) | Target Range (mmol/L) | |----------------------|----------------------|-----------------------| | Before a meal | 80-130 | 4.4-7.2 | | 1-2 hours after meal | Less than 180 | Less than 10.0 | | Bedtime | 90-150 | 5.0-8.3 |

Source: American Diabetes Association

Important Considerations:

  • Individual Factors: These ranges are general guidelines. Your healthcare provider may adjust your target range based on factors like age, pregnancy, other medical conditions, and the type of diabetes medication you are taking.
  • Type 1 vs. Type 2 Diabetes: While the general targets are similar, management strategies and insulin requirements can differ significantly between type 1 and type 2 diabetes.
  • Continuous Glucose Monitoring (CGM): If you use a CGM, your healthcare provider may set specific targets for time-in-range (the percentage of time your blood sugar is within your target range), which can provide a more comprehensive picture of your blood sugar control.

Example Scenario:

Imagine you are monitoring your blood sugar before breakfast. A reading of 110 mg/dL falls within the recommended target range of 80-130 mg/dL. However, if you check your blood sugar two hours after eating and it's consistently above 180 mg/dL, it may indicate that you need to adjust your meal plan, medication, or activity level.

Factors Influencing Blood Sugar Levels

Many factors can influence blood sugar levels, making diabetes management a dynamic and ongoing process. Understanding these factors is crucial for anticipating fluctuations and taking proactive steps to maintain a healthy range.

Here are some key factors:

  1. Food and Diet:

    • Carbohydrate Intake: Carbohydrates are the primary source of glucose in the diet. The type and amount of carbohydrates you consume directly impact blood sugar levels. High-glycemic index foods (e.g., white bread, sugary drinks) cause rapid spikes in blood sugar, while low-glycemic index foods (e.g., whole grains, vegetables) are digested more slowly and have a more gradual effect.
    • Portion Size: Eating large portions of any food, even healthy options, can lead to elevated blood sugar levels. Portion control is a critical component of diabetes management.
    • Meal Timing: Spacing meals and snacks evenly throughout the day can help maintain more stable blood sugar levels. Skipping meals or going long periods without eating can lead to blood sugar fluctuations.
  2. Physical Activity:

    • Type of Exercise: Both aerobic exercise (e.g., walking, swimming) and resistance training (e.g., weight lifting) can improve insulin sensitivity and lower blood sugar levels.
    • Intensity and Duration: The intensity and duration of exercise also play a role. More intense or longer workouts generally have a greater impact on blood sugar.
    • Timing of Exercise: Exercising shortly after a meal can help prevent blood sugar spikes.
  3. Medications:

    • Insulin: Individuals with type 1 diabetes and some with type 2 diabetes require insulin to regulate blood sugar levels. The type, dosage, and timing of insulin injections or infusions are critical.
    • Oral Medications: Several types of oral medications are available to help lower blood sugar levels in individuals with type 2 diabetes. These medications work through various mechanisms, such as increasing insulin production, improving insulin sensitivity, or reducing glucose absorption.
  4. Stress:

    • Hormonal Effects: When you're stressed, your body releases hormones like cortisol and adrenaline, which can raise blood sugar levels.
    • Coping Mechanisms: Some people cope with stress by eating unhealthy foods or neglecting their diabetes management, which can further impact blood sugar.
  5. Illness:

    • Increased Glucose Production: During illness, the body produces more glucose to fuel the immune system, which can lead to elevated blood sugar levels.
    • Reduced Appetite: Reduced appetite and changes in activity levels during illness can also impact blood sugar management.
  6. Sleep:

    • Insulin Resistance: Insufficient sleep can lead to insulin resistance, making it harder for the body to use insulin effectively.
    • Hormonal Imbalance: Sleep deprivation can also disrupt hormone levels that regulate blood sugar.
  7. Dehydration:

    • Concentrated Glucose: When you're dehydrated, your blood becomes more concentrated, which can lead to higher blood sugar readings.

Practical Examples:

  • Scenario 1 (Food): If you know that a particular pasta dish tends to cause your blood sugar to spike, try reducing the portion size, choosing whole-wheat pasta, or pairing it with a protein and fiber-rich side dish to slow down glucose absorption.
  • Scenario 2 (Exercise): If you're planning a long hike, check your blood sugar before, during, and after to monitor the impact and adjust your insulin or carbohydrate intake as needed.
  • Scenario 3 (Stress): Practice relaxation techniques like deep breathing or meditation to help manage stress and prevent blood sugar spikes.
  • Scenario 4 (Illness): During a cold or flu, monitor your blood sugar more frequently and follow your healthcare provider's recommendations for adjusting your medication.

By understanding these factors and how they influence your blood sugar levels, you can develop a more personalized and effective diabetes management plan. Regularly monitoring your blood sugar and working closely with your healthcare team are key to maintaining a healthy range and preventing complications.

Strategies for Maintaining a Normal Blood Sugar Range

Maintaining a normal blood sugar range requires a multifaceted approach encompassing dietary changes, regular physical activity, medication management, and lifestyle adjustments. Here's a breakdown of actionable strategies to help you effectively manage your blood sugar levels:

  1. Dietary Strategies:

    • Balanced Meal Planning:
      • Focus on whole, unprocessed foods like fruits, vegetables, lean proteins, and whole grains.
      • Divide your plate into portions: half non-starchy vegetables, one-quarter lean protein, and one-quarter whole grains.
      • Work with a registered dietitian or certified diabetes educator to create a personalized meal plan that meets your individual needs and preferences.
    • Carbohydrate Counting:
      • Learn how to count carbohydrates to better manage your blood sugar levels.
      • Understand the carbohydrate content of different foods and how they impact your blood sugar.
      • Use tools like carbohydrate counting apps or guides to track your intake.
    • Glycemic Index (GI) and Glycemic Load (GL):
      • Choose foods with a low to moderate GI and GL to minimize blood sugar spikes.
      • Understand the difference between GI and GL and how they affect your blood sugar.
      • Examples:
        • Low GI: Sweet potatoes, beans, lentils
        • High GI: White bread, white rice, sugary drinks
      • Reference GI and GL charts when making food choices.
    • Portion Control:
      • Use smaller plates and bowls to help control portion sizes.
      • Measure your food to ensure accurate portions.
      • Avoid eating directly from large containers.
    • Hydration:
      • Drink plenty of water throughout the day to stay hydrated.
      • Avoid sugary drinks like soda, juice, and sweetened beverages.
      • Aim for at least 8 glasses of water per day, or more if you are active or in a hot climate.
    • Fiber-Rich Foods:
      • Increase your intake of fiber-rich foods like vegetables, fruits, whole grains, and legumes.
      • Fiber slows down glucose absorption and helps stabilize blood sugar levels.
      • Aim for at least 25-35 grams of fiber per day.
  2. Physical Activity:

    • Regular Exercise:
      • Aim for at least 150 minutes of moderate-intensity aerobic exercise per week (e.g., brisk walking, swimming, cycling).
      • Incorporate resistance training (e.g., weight lifting, bodyweight exercises) at least 2-3 times per week.
      • Find activities you enjoy and can incorporate into your routine.
    • Timing of Exercise:
      • Exercise after meals can help lower blood sugar levels.
      • Avoid exercising when your blood sugar is too high or too low.
      • Check your blood sugar before, during, and after exercise, especially when starting a new activity or changing your routine.
    • Variety of Activities:
      • Mix up your workouts to prevent boredom and work different muscle groups.
      • Examples:
        • Aerobic: Walking, running, swimming, dancing
        • Resistance: Weight lifting, bodyweight exercises, resistance bands
        • Flexibility: Yoga, stretching
  3. Medication Management:

    • Adherence to Prescriptions:
      • Take your diabetes medications as prescribed by your healthcare provider.
      • Don't skip doses or change your medication without consulting your doctor.
      • Use a pill organizer or reminder system to help you stay on track.
    • Insulin Therapy:
      • Learn how to properly administer insulin, including injection techniques and timing.
      • Understand the different types of insulin and how they work.
      • Monitor your blood sugar regularly and adjust your insulin dosage as needed, under the guidance of your healthcare provider.
    • Oral Medications:
      • Understand how your oral medications work and their potential side effects.
      • Take your medications at the recommended times, usually with meals.
      • If you experience side effects, talk to your healthcare provider.
  4. Lifestyle Adjustments:

    • Stress Management:
      • Practice relaxation techniques like deep breathing, meditation, or yoga.
      • Engage in hobbies and activities that you enjoy.
      • Seek support from friends, family, or a therapist if you are struggling with stress.
    • Sleep Hygiene:
      • Aim for 7-9 hours of quality sleep per night.
      • Establish a regular sleep schedule and stick to it as much as possible.
      • Create a relaxing bedtime routine to promote restful sleep.
    • Regular Monitoring:
      • Check your blood sugar regularly as recommended by your healthcare provider.
      • Keep a log of your blood sugar readings and any factors that may have influenced them.
      • Use a blood glucose meter or continuous glucose monitoring (CGM) system to monitor your blood sugar.
    • Education and Support:
      • Attend diabetes education classes or workshops.
      • Join a support group or connect with other people with diabetes.
      • Stay informed about the latest diabetes research and management strategies.

By implementing these strategies, you can take proactive steps to maintain a normal blood sugar range and reduce your risk of diabetes complications. Remember that managing diabetes is a team effort. Work closely with your healthcare provider, registered dietitian, and certified diabetes educator to develop a personalized plan that meets your unique needs and goals.

The Role of Technology in Blood Sugar Management

Technology plays an increasingly important role in blood sugar management for individuals with diabetes. Advanced devices and digital tools can provide real-time data, automate insulin delivery, and offer personalized insights to help you stay within your target range.

Here's a look at some key technological advancements:

  1. Continuous Glucose Monitoring (CGM) Systems:

    • How They Work: CGMs use a small sensor inserted under the skin to continuously measure glucose levels in interstitial fluid. They transmit data to a receiver or smartphone, providing real-time glucose readings and trends.
    • Benefits:
      • Real-Time Data: Provides continuous glucose readings every few minutes, allowing you to see how your blood sugar is changing throughout the day and night.
      • Trend Arrows: Shows the direction and speed of glucose changes, helping you anticipate and prevent highs and lows.
      • Alerts: Sends alerts when glucose levels are too high or too low, allowing you to take corrective action.
      • Data Tracking: Collects data over time, allowing you to track trends and identify patterns.
    • Examples: Dexcom G6, Abbott FreeStyle Libre, Medtronic Guardian Connect
  2. Insulin Pumps:

    • How They Work: Insulin pumps deliver a continuous, steady stream of insulin (basal rate) throughout the day and bolus doses of insulin at mealtimes or to correct high blood sugar levels.
    • Benefits:
      • Precise Insulin Delivery: Provides more precise insulin delivery than multiple daily injections, mimicking the way a healthy pancreas works.
      • Customizable Basal Rates: Allows you to customize basal rates to meet your individual needs at different times of the day.
      • Bolus Calculator: Helps you calculate the appropriate bolus dose based on your blood sugar level and carbohydrate intake.
      • Flexibility: Offers more flexibility in meal timing and exercise.
    • Examples: Medtronic MiniMed, Tandem Diabetes Care t:slim X2, Insulet OmniPod
  3. Closed-Loop Systems (Artificial Pancreas):

    • How They Work: Closed-loop systems combine a CGM, an insulin pump, and a sophisticated algorithm to automatically adjust insulin delivery based on real-time glucose readings.
    • Benefits:
      • Automated Insulin Delivery: Automates insulin delivery, reducing the need for manual adjustments.
      • Improved Glucose Control: Helps maintain more stable glucose levels and reduces the risk of hypoglycemia and hyperglycemia.
      • Reduced Burden: Reduces the mental and physical burden of diabetes management.
    • Examples: Medtronic MiniMed 780G, Tandem Diabetes Care Control-IQ
  4. Mobile Apps and Software:

    • How They Work: Mobile apps and software can help you track your blood sugar, carbohydrate intake, physical activity, and medication. They can also provide personalized insights and recommendations.
    • Benefits:
      • Data Tracking: Allows you to track your diabetes data in one place.
      • Personalized Insights: Provides personalized insights based on your data.
      • Education and Support: Offers educational resources and support.
      • Remote Monitoring: Allows your healthcare provider to monitor your data remotely.
    • Examples: mySugr, Diabetes:M, Glooko
  5. Smart Insulin Pens:

    • How They Work: Smart insulin pens track the dosage and timing of insulin injections and can connect to mobile apps to provide data tracking and analysis.
    • Benefits:
      • Dosage Tracking: Tracks the dosage and timing of insulin injections.
      • Data Analysis: Provides data analysis to help you identify patterns and trends.
      • Integration with Apps: Integrates with mobile apps for data tracking and sharing.
    • Examples: NovoPen 6, Lilly Tempo Smart Button

Benefits of Using Technology:

  • Improved Glucose Control: Technology can help you achieve better glucose control and reduce the risk of complications.
  • Greater Flexibility: Technology can provide more flexibility in meal timing, exercise, and other activities.
  • Reduced Burden: Technology can reduce the mental and physical burden of diabetes management.
  • Personalized Insights: Technology can provide personalized insights to help you make better decisions about your diabetes care.

Considerations:

  • Cost: Some technologies can be expensive.
  • Training: You may need training to use the technology effectively.
  • Maintenance: Technology requires maintenance, such as sensor changes and battery replacements.
  • Accuracy: Technology is not always perfect and may occasionally provide inaccurate readings.

Technology can be a powerful tool for managing diabetes and improving your quality of life. Talk to your healthcare provider to determine which technologies are right for you.

Common Myths About Blood Sugar and Diabetes

There are many misconceptions about blood sugar and diabetes that can lead to confusion and ineffective management. It's crucial to dispel these myths with accurate information to empower individuals with diabetes to make informed decisions about their health.

Here are some common myths and the corresponding facts:

Myth 1: People with diabetes can't eat sugar.

  • Fact: People with diabetes can eat sugar, but it needs to be carefully managed as part of a balanced diet. The key is to monitor carbohydrate intake, including sugars, and balance it with medication, exercise, and meal timing. A registered dietitian or certified diabetes educator can help create a personalized meal plan that includes reasonable amounts of sugar.

Myth 2: Diabetes is caused by eating too much sugar.

  • Fact: Type 1 diabetes is an autoimmune condition where the body's immune system attacks the insulin-producing cells in the pancreas. Type 2 diabetes is influenced by a combination of genetic and lifestyle factors, including obesity, physical inactivity, and family history. While a diet high in sugary foods can contribute to weight gain and increase the risk of type 2 diabetes, it's not the sole cause.

Myth 3: All carbohydrates are bad for people with diabetes.

  • Fact: Not all carbohydrates are created equal. Complex carbohydrates found in whole grains, vegetables, and fruits are digested more slowly and have a more gradual effect on blood sugar levels compared to simple carbohydrates found in sugary foods and refined grains. Choosing complex carbohydrates over simple carbohydrates is recommended.

Myth 4: People with diabetes should only eat "diabetic" foods.

  • Fact: There's no need to buy special "diabetic" foods, which are often expensive and offer no real advantage. A healthy diet for someone with diabetes is the same as a healthy diet for anyone else: one that is rich in fruits, vegetables, whole grains, lean proteins, and healthy fats.

Myth 5: Only overweight people get type 2 diabetes.

  • Fact: While obesity is a major risk factor for type 2 diabetes, people of normal weight can also develop the condition. Other risk factors include age, family history, ethnicity, and physical inactivity.

Myth 6: Once you start taking insulin, you can never stop.

  • Fact: Some people with type 2 diabetes may be able to reduce or discontinue insulin therapy with lifestyle changes such as weight loss, increased physical activity, and dietary modifications, under the guidance of their healthcare provider. People with type 1 diabetes require lifelong insulin therapy.

Myth 7: Diabetes is not a serious condition.

  • Fact: Diabetes is a serious condition that can lead to a range of complications, including heart disease, kidney disease, nerve damage, and vision loss. However, with proper management, people with diabetes can live long and healthy lives.

Myth 8: Fruit is bad for people with diabetes.

  • Fact: Fruits are part of a healthy diet for people with diabetes, as long as they are consumed in moderation and balanced with other foods. Some fruits have a lower glycemic index and glycemic load, making them a better choice.

Myth 9: Exercise always lowers blood sugar.

  • Fact: While exercise generally lowers blood sugar, it can sometimes raise it, especially during high-intensity activities. It's important to monitor blood sugar levels before, during, and after exercise to understand how your body responds and adjust your medication or carbohydrate intake as needed.

Myth 10: Natural remedies can cure diabetes.

  • Fact: There is no cure for diabetes. While some natural remedies may help manage blood sugar levels, they should not be used as a substitute for medical treatment. It's essential to work with a healthcare provider to develop a comprehensive diabetes management plan.

By debunking these myths and providing accurate information, we can help people with diabetes make informed decisions about their health and empower them to live their best lives.

Resources and Support for People with Diabetes

Living with diabetes can be challenging, but you don't have to do it alone. Numerous resources and support networks are available to help you manage your condition, connect with others, and stay informed.

Here are some key resources and support options:

  1. Healthcare Professionals:

    • Endocrinologist: A doctor who specializes in diabetes and other endocrine disorders. They can help you manage your blood sugar levels, adjust your medication, and monitor for complications.
    • Certified Diabetes Educator (CDE): A healthcare professional who provides education and support on all aspects of diabetes management, including diet, exercise, medication, and blood sugar monitoring.
    • Registered Dietitian (RD): A nutrition expert who can help you develop a personalized meal plan to manage your blood sugar levels and meet your nutritional needs.
    • Primary Care Physician (PCP): Your main doctor can provide ongoing care, monitor your overall health, and coordinate your diabetes care with other specialists.
    • Other Specialists: Depending on your individual needs, you may also benefit from seeing a podiatrist (for foot care), an ophthalmologist (for eye exams), a nephrologist (for kidney care), or a cardiologist (for heart care).
  2. Diabetes Organizations:

    • American Diabetes Association (ADA): A leading organization that provides information, resources, and advocacy for people with diabetes. They offer educational materials, support groups, and events.
    • Juvenile Diabetes Research Foundation (JDRF): Focuses on research to find a cure for type 1 diabetes. They also provide support and resources for people with type 1 diabetes and their families.
    • Diabetes Research Institute Foundation (DRIF): Supports research to find a biological cure for diabetes.
    • Taking Control Of Your Diabetes (TCOYD): Offers conferences, workshops, and online resources to help people with diabetes take control of their health.
